When You Have a Landscaping Emergency
Some problems can’t wait. An emergency landscaping issue is anything that poses an immediate threat to people, your home, or important structures. Here are clear examples:
- A large tree or big limb has fallen and is leaning against your house, garage, or car.
- Fast-moving water from heavy rain is causing serious erosion, washing soil away from your home’s foundation or driveway.
- Your yard is flooded, and the standing water is getting close to your septic tank or utility lines.
- You can see exposed utility lines or pipes after a storm. (Your first call should always be to the utility company).
- There are large branches tangled in power lines. Never approach these—call your utility company and then a professional.
Safety always comes first. If you’re unsure, it’s better to call a pro and describe the situation.
Understanding Chadbourn's Soil, Climate, and Plants
The work needed for your yard is deeply affected by our local conditions. Chadbourn has a humid climate with hot summers and occasional heavy downpours. This can stress lawns and plants, making proper irrigation and drainage key. Our soils often have a mix of sand and clay, which affects how water drains and what plants thrive. Homes in older neighborhoods, like those near downtown Chadbourn, might have majestic, mature trees that need careful care. Newer developments might have different challenges with smaller yards and newer soil. If you live near a waterway or have a mobile home, proper grading and drainage are especially important to prevent flooding. Choosing plants that can handle our humidity and occasional cooler snaps will save you time and money.

What Does Landscaping Service Cost in Chadbourn?
Costs depend on many factors. To provide accurate local information, we checked current averages for labor and project costs in Columbus County, NC. Based on local industry sources and contractor estimates, here’s a transparent breakdown:
- Emergency Call-Out: For urgent after-hours service, there is typically a premium fee, often ranging from $100 to $300, on top of labor and materials.
- Labor: Work is often priced hourly ($50-$80/hr per crew member) or as a flat-rate project.
- Materials: Costs for sod, mulch, stone, and plants vary. Sod can range from $0.30 to $0.80 per square foot for the material alone.
- Equipment: Specialized jobs may have fees for equipment like chippers or cranes.
- Disposal: Hauling away debris, like tree limbs or old concrete, usually costs extra.
- Permits: Some tree removals or major hardscaping projects may require a permit from the town, adding to the cost.
Example Project Cost Ranges (Estimates):
- Emergency Fallen Small Tree Removal: $200 – $800, depending on size and access.
- Large Tree Removal (Requiring Crane/Permit): $1,200 – $5,000+.
- Drainage Correction (French Drain): $1,000 – $4,000, based on length and complexity.
- New Sod Installation: $1,000 – $3,000 for an average-sized Chadbourn yard.
- Irrigation Repair: Service call/diagnosis: $75-$150; repairs: $100-$800+.
Emergency visits cost more because they require mobilizing a crew quickly, often outside normal business hours, and may need last-minute equipment rentals.

Safety First: What to Do Until Help Arrives
If you have a landscaping emergency, follow these steps to stay safe:
- Keep everyone, including pets, away from the hazard zone.
- If you see downed power lines, stay far back and call the utility company immediately. Do not touch them.
- Take photos of the damage for your insurance claim.
- Move vehicles away from fallen trees or flooding areas.
- If a broken pipe is flooding your yard, shut off the main irrigation valve to save water.
- Secure any loose patio furniture or objects that high winds could pick up.
Important Warning: Do not try to remove large trees or limbs yourself. It’s dangerous. Always use licensed, insured professionals. And remember, always call 811 to have underground utilities marked before any digging project.
Local Permits and Rules in Chadbourn
Before starting certain projects, check local requirements. For tree removal, Chadbourn or Columbus County may have rules about removing protected or heritage trees, especially in historic areas. If you live in a neighborhood with a Homeowners Association (HOA), check their rules for any visible changes. Significant work like building a large retaining wall or altering drainage may need a permit from the town. For the most current rules, we recommend contacting the Chadbourn Town Hall or Columbus County Building Inspections department. They can provide specific guidance for your project.
